In some cases Many individuals ponder what double glazing specifically is and what benefits it delivers to a residence. Double-glazed windows and balcony doors are made out of two glasses which have been separated by a layer of dehydrated air or argon gas and both glasses are sealed around the perimeter so that this dehydrated air or argon fuel will not escape.
